Course Content

• Plant Immunity: An Introduction to Innate and Adaptive Immunity
• Plant Pathogen Interactions: Recognition and Response
• Signaling Molecules in Plant Immunity: Hormones and Secondary Metabolites
• Plant Immune Signaling Pathways: Jasmonic Acid, Salicylic Acid, and Ethylene Pathways
• Receptor-like Kinases (RLKs) and Plant Disease Resistance
• Transcriptional Regulation in Plant Defense Responses
• Programmed Cell Death in Plant Immunity
• Plant Immune System Evasion by Pathogens
• Developing Disease-Resistant Crops: Applications of Plant Immune Signaling
• Advanced Techniques in Plant Immune Signaling Research (e.g., Genomics, Proteomics)
